Helsinki-based progressive heavy rock band 3rd Trip returns today with their second full-length album, Mosaic. Their debut, Scale of Confusion, was released in 2017, making this follow-up a highly anticipated arrival nearly ten years in the making.
Alongside the album release, a music video has been unveiled for the closing track, Get Along and Proceed. The band’s sound has evolved since their debut, moving in a more progressive and experimental direction, as their new lyric video demonstrates.
“We’ve been crafting this album carefully since 2020,” says guitarist Marko Puhakka. “The songs took shape over several years before the full picture finally fell into place. Tool has been a major inspiration for us, and perhaps we’ve fallen into the same rabbit hole with album-making, as it always takes the time it needs to be truly ready.”
Drummer Joona Mikkonen-Pakkala adds:
“We also decided to release a lyric video alongside the album. We’re thrilled with the result, it’s full of emotion. It was created by my longtime friend Mark Hobson, who also handled the live visuals for our first album.”
Mosaic was recorded in spring 2024 at Sound Ateljee Studio in Lohja, with recording, mixing, and mastering handled by Sammy Roiha. A limited edition vinyl pressing of 200 copies will also be available later this spring via the band’s Bandcamp page.
